About This Item

J. Murray, London, 1839. First Edition. Hardcover. Good. [19th Century Observations of Ottoman Turkey, Persia, Russia, Kurds, and Armenia] Bound in publisher's cloth. Hardcover. Spine taped. Scattered markings/underlining. 1 preliminary leaf, [vii]-xvii, [1], 477 pages frontispiece, 4 plates, folded map , 22 cm. Name on title. Blind stamps. Refs: Ghani p.398; Wilson p. 243.
